Kimberly-Clark posts combined Q2 outcomes, shares dip barely By Investing.com

DALLAS – Kimberly-Clark Company (NYSE: NYSE:) introduced its second-quarter outcomes, surpassing analyst earnings expectations however falling brief on income forecasts.

The corporate reported adjusted earnings per share (EPS) of $1.96, which was $0.25 larger than the analyst estimate of $1.71. Nevertheless, the reported income of $5 billion for the quarter didn’t meet the consensus estimate of $5.09 billion. Regardless of the earnings beat, shares of Kimberly-Clark dipped by 1.49% because the market reacted to the income shortfall.

The corporate’s efficiency this quarter demonstrated a strong 19% improve in adjusted EPS in comparison with the prior yr, regardless of a 2% decline in internet gross sales. Natural gross sales progress stood at 4%, pushed by a mixture of price will increase and quantity progress. Kimberly-Clark’s strategic pricing actions, significantly in hyperinflationary economies like Argentina, and quantity and blend enhancements throughout varied markets contributed to this progress.

Chairman and CEO Mike Hsu expressed pleasure within the firm’s development of its new working mannequin and supply of high-quality outcomes. He highlighted the corporate’s give attention to delivering client options at each price level and enhancing operational scale to spice up long-term potential.

Kimberly-Clark’s working revenue for the quarter was $655 million, with adjusted working revenue rising by 16%. This progress was achieved regardless of a 7 share level unfavorable influence from forex translation, primarily on account of hyperinflationary economies.

Excluding forex impacts, the expansion in adjusted working revenue was attributed to natural progress and productiveness positive factors, which have been partially offset by enter value inflation and elevated bills in advertising and marketing, research, and basic operations.

Wanting forward, Kimberly-Clark has raised its 2024 outlook based mostly on sturdy first-half outcomes. The corporate now expects mid-to-high teenagers share charge progress in adjusted working revenue and adjusted EPS on a constant-currency foundation, an improve from earlier low-teens progress expectations. Nevertheless, reported working revenue and EPS are nonetheless anticipated to be negatively impacted by forex translation.
